## Basement Archive Room — Access

The archive room (B-04, Merrowfield House basement) holds contract files and legacy records. Facilities desk staff may grant access only to named requesters on the archive register; check the register before issuing entry. Boxes must not leave the basement without a withdrawal slip. The room is climate-controlled — keep the door closed at all times and report any humidity alarm immediately. The keypad code for B-04 is below.

door code, yagap-bahof: bdg-O-05

**Digest scheduling — onboarding**

Welcome to Mailwick. Batch digests run via the `digestd` scheduler, not cron. Contractors touch only the staging tier. To change a digest window, edit `schedules/staging.yaml`, bump the revision, and open a merge request tagged `digest-sched`. Never schedule batches inside the 02:00–03:00 maintenance freeze. Local test runs use `digestd --dry-run` against the sandbox queue. Before your first push, register the staging deploy key with the Mailwick ops vault. Use the key below.

rollout seal: bky9_PeXH1fTLY

## GC Pauses in MatchCore

The MatchCore matching service occasionally stalls during major garbage-collection cycles, which shows up as paired-request timeouts in the Larkfield dashboard. If a pause exceeds two seconds, restart the affected node and restore its heap snapshot from the sealed archive. Decrypting that archive requires the recovery passphrase listed below.

recovery phrase for bawef-haduf: wenax-druox-julmir